Road or pavement problem

All council-maintained roads and pavements in the borough are regularly inspected - every month for major roads, and every three or six months for residential roads. Defects such as potholes or uneven pavements are noted during these inspections and are prioritised in line with the level of danger. We also carry out a yearly condition survey of all council-maintained pavements and roads. An independent highway inspector notes and measures any defects in each section of pavement or road, then calculates a condition rating for each section. This helps us choose the streets for the yearly resurfacing programme.
